Technological innovation and consumer demands are driving the next wave of infrastructure investment with over $69 trillion of spending1 required through 2035. Brookfield is one of the world’s largest owners/operators of infrastructure and renewables; investing in the sector since 2000 and using our expertise to provide an informed perspective. We will reveal the forward-looking themes across energy, communications and transport sectors that are creating opportunities for investors, while answering these key questions:

  • How do we define the infrastructure investment universe?
  • How is the renewables revolution impacting worldwide production and consumption of energy?
  • How are communication towers poised to benefit from the exponential increase in mobile data?
  • What are the innovative solutions addressing urban congestion and how could it benefit all drivers?
  • How are companies exploiting these trends?
  • How can investors capitalize on these themes in a single portfolio?
